Description

A kind of splash bar improving release agent reaction efficiency
Technical field
The utility model relates to release agent reaction unit technical field, and in particular to a kind of to improve release agent reaction efficiency Splash bar.
Background technique
Release agent is a kind of auxiliary agent for molding being prepared using organic substance.During producing release agent, It include mixing step, which needs the raw material of production release agent to be sufficiently mixed reaction.In the prior art, for stirring The splash bar of release agent is only in the splash bar with stirring-head, but release agent raw material has biggish toughness, and existing splash bar needs Long period can just be sufficiently mixed reaction raw materials, or cannot effectively blend feedstock.
Utility model content
For the prior art there are above-mentioned technical problem, the utility model provides a kind of stirring for raising release agent reaction efficiency Stick, the splash bar can effectively improve the production efficiency of release agent.
To achieve the above object, the utility model the following technical schemes are provided:
There is provided it is a kind of improve release agent reaction efficiency splash bar, including shaft and be disposed around the shaft surrounding several The body of rod, the axle body of the shaft are equipped with stirring blade, which is enclosed by several described bodies of rod sets, several described bars One end of body is each attached on an end plate, and the other end is fixed on motor, the one end of the shaft and motor Power output axis connection, the other end pass through the end plate, and the axial direction of the shaft is identical as the axial direction of the body of rod.
Wherein, the body of rod is four, and four bodies of rod are uniformly disposed around the surrounding of the shaft.
Wherein, there are six the stirring blade, this six stirring blades form a circle and are located on the axle body of the shaft.
Wherein, the stirring blade has in the unfolded state stretched perpendicular to rotor shaft direction and in rotor shaft direction withdrawal Folded state.
Wherein, the end plate is circular end plate, and the shaft passes through the center of the circular end plate, and four bodies of rod are uniform It is fixed on all edges of the circular end plate.
Wherein, the end of the body of rod is each attached on a cranse, the body of rod by cranse hoop be located on motor from And it is fixed on motor.
Wherein, be connected on the end plate one for supply a lasso passing through of the shaft.
Wherein, the stirring blade is each attached on a retainer plate, the stirring blade by the retainer plate from institute The axle body for stating shaft is detachably connected.
The utility model has the beneficial effects that
Since shaft and stirring blade are surrounded by the body of rod, when being stirred raw material, raw material is not only stirred blade and stirs It mixes, and raw material screws in stirring blade and all collided by the body of rod when screwing out stirring blade, therefore improves the stirring rate of raw material, in turn Reaction efficiency can be improved within a short period of time.
